The programme route is suitable for doctors.
This internationally renowned programme is the longest-established Sports and Exercise Medicine Post-Graduate programme in the country, with a prestigious history.
The programme is based on the philosophy of total care for the athlete and the promotion of physical activity in the general population.
This programme will:
Offer you mastery of foundation concepts and skills in Sports and Exercise Medicine.
Give you the knowledge and skills to assess sports injuries and to understand their treatment options, as well as understanding the physiological and psychological benefits of exercise and its use as a health tool.
Allow you regular clinical contact with athletes and sportspeople.
Introduce you to visiting lecturers, who are experts in the field of Sports Medicine.
Career paths
Successful alumni have gone on to further study at PhD level, to work in specialised roles in sports medicine and to hold pivotal positions in the field across the UK and internationally. Graduates include the Chief Medical Officers for Team Great Britain at the Beijing 2008 and London 2012 Olympic and Paralympic games, and the Greek team at Athens 2004.
